Material Selection: Durability, Breathability, Safety
The fabric is the very genesis of the garment’s capabilities. From robust poly-cotton blends engineered for rip resistance to specialized technical textiles featuring flame retardancy or enhanced moisture-wicking properties, the choice is intricate, demanding expert navigation. We often find ourselves, here at the factory, dissecting fabric samples, testing tensile strengths, scrutinizing weave patterns under magnification.
Here's a brief, yet critical, overview of some prevalent material considerations:
Table: Key Workwear Fabric Properties
| Fabric Type | Primary Benefit | Application Context |
|---|
| Poly-Cotton Twill | Durability, Comfort | General industrial, light-duty, logistics |
| Ripstop Fabric | Tear Resistance | Outdoor, demanding environments, construction |
| Stretch Blends | Enhanced Mobility | Roles requiring frequent bending, climbing, agility |
| Flame-Resistant (FR) | Fire Protection | Welding, chemical handling, electrical work |
| Water-Repellent | Moisture Protection | Outdoor work, wet conditions, cleaning services |
Specialized Pockets, Reinforcements, and Tool Holders
The strategic placement of pockets—oh, the sheer utility of a well-designed pocket!—or the inclusion of reinforced stress points transforms a basic trouser into a highly efficient mobile toolkit. Knee pad pockets, hammer loops, utility pockets for specialized instruments—these are not mere additions; they are indispensable ergonomic enhancements.
Reinforcements at critical wear areas, such as the crotch, knees, and hems, dramatically extend the garment's operational lifespan. This is an absolutely undeniable axiom of workwear longevity. We employ double-stitching, bar-tacking, and robust fabric overlays to ensure a garment won't simply give up the ghost prematurely. Weather Resistance, Visibility, and Mobility Options
For outdoor teams, or those operating in low-light conditions, integrating features like water-resistant finishes or high-visibility reflective strips becomes, quite literally, a matter of safety. The options are manifold: articulated knees for unrestricted movement, gusseted crotches to prevent tearing during strenuous activity, ventilation zippers for thermal regulation.

Elevating Safety and Performance for "Apex Logistics"**
A regional logistics giant, "Apex Logistics," faced a persistent predicament. Their previous supplier provided generic work trousers, leading to constant complaints: premature tearing in the crotch, inadequate pockets for scanners, and dismal thermal comfort during Guangzhou's sweltering summers.
Employee morale, not surprisingly, was plummeting; safety incidents, sadly, were on the rise due to restricted movement. This was a truly catastrophic situation.
We engaged Apex Logistics in an exhaustive needs assessment, dissecting their operational workflows and environmental challenges.
Our engineers then developed a bespoke design: a lightweight yet incredibly robust ripstop poly-cotton blend, featuring strategically gusseted crotches for unhindered movement, reinforced knee sections, and specific, easily accessible pockets tailored for handheld scanners and communication devices. We even integrated subtle reflective piping for enhanced visibility in low-light warehouse conditions.
The results? Transformative, undeniably. Apex Logistics reported a 40% reduction in workwear replacement costs within the first year, an appreciable improvement in employee satisfaction surveys, and, most importantly, a measurable decrease in movement-related injuries.
